Consumer Electronics vs. Industrial Silicone Keypad: Why the Same Specs Deliver Different Lifespans

Aug 13,2026

🔬 On paper, a consumer silicone keypad and an industrial version may share the same actuation force, travel, and contact resistance. Yet in the field, the industrial keypad lasts 5–10 times longer. The difference lies not in the specs alone, but in the engineering choices behind them.

Consumer Electronics Silicone Keypad

Designed for cost‑sensitive, indoor use
  • Target life: 100k–300k cycles
  • Material: Generic silicone, limited filler control
  • Environment: Stable temperature, low UV, occasional cleaning
  • Testing: Basic functional test at room temperature
  • Failure mode: Legend wear, force drift, contact resistance rise
⏱️ 1–3 years typical lifespan

Industrial Instrumentation Silicone Keypad

Engineered for reliability in harsh conditions
  • Target life: 1M–5M cycles (10+ years)
  • Material: Premium compounds, low‑Tg, UV‑stabilised
  • Environment: –40°C to +85°C, solvents, dust, vibration
  • Testing: Thermal cycling, 20k wipe test, 85/85 humidity
  • Failure mode: Minimal – designed for graceful aging
⏱️ 10+ years typical lifespan

Why the Same Silicone Keypad Specs Yield Different Lifespans

Factor Consumer Grade Industrial Grade Lifespan Impact
Elastomer Hardness (Shore A) ±5 tolerance ±2 tolerance Industrial maintains consistent force over time
Carbon Filler Dispersion Low uniformity → resistance drift High uniformity → stable contact Industrial contact resistance drift <5%
Legend Durability Screen‑printed, no overcoat Epoxy ink + UV hard coat Industrial survives 20k IPA wipes
Temperature Validation Room temperature only –40°C to +85°C + thermal cycling Industrial performs across global climates
Lifecycle Testing 100k cycles (often theoretical) 1M+ cycles with force‑stroke monitoring Industrial verified to 10‑year life
Process Capability (Cpk) Typically <1.33 ≥1.67 Industrial batch‑to‑batch consistency

The table above reveals the truth: specs are necessary but not sufficient. A consumer keypad and an industrial keypad can both specify "150g actuation force" and "≤200Ω contact resistance". But the industrial keypad maintains those values over a decade of thermal cycling, chemical cleaning, and millions of presses, while the consumer keypad drifts out of spec within months.

The hidden differentiators are material purity, filler morphology, process control, and validation depth. Industrial suppliers invest in compound development, in‑line SPC, and environmental testing that consumer suppliers routinely skip to keep costs low.

Making the Right Choice

  • Understand your environment: Temperature range, cleaning chemicals, and usage frequency define the required grade.
  • Look beyond the datasheet: Ask for ageing test data, Cpk values, and material certifications.
  • Consider total cost of ownership: A cheaper consumer keypad may fail early, costing more in field replacements and reputation.
  • Partner with an industrial specialist: Choose a supplier who validates their keypads for your specific conditions.
